Exploring the Versatility and Durability of Stainless Spring Steel

Stainless spring steel is a highly versatile and durable material that finds numerous applications across various industries. From automotive to construction, manufacturing to aerospace, stainless spring steel plays a crucial role in enhancing the performance and reliability of different components. This article aims to delve into the characteristics and applications of stainless spring steel, highlighting its exceptional properties that set it apart from other materials.

One of the primary reasons stainless spring steel is widely used is its remarkable resistance to corrosion. Stainless steel contains chromium, which forms a thin and protective oxide layer on the surface, preventing the material from rusting or corroding. This makes it an ideal choice for applications where the components are exposed to harsh environmental conditions or chemicals. For instance, stainless spring steel is commonly used in marine equipment, oil and gas pipelines, and chemical processing plants.

Another notable feature of stainless spring steel is its excellent strength and durability. It possesses high tensile strength and can withstand heavy loads and stresses without deformation or fracture. This property makes stainless spring steel suitable for applications that require components to bounce back to their original shape after being subjected to pressure or force. These applications include springs, clips, fasteners, and various mechanical components.

Moreover, stainless spring steel exhibits exceptional heat resistance. It can withstand high temperatures without losing its mechanical properties, making it suitable for applications in industries such as aerospace and automotive. For example, stainless spring steel is used in engine valves, exhaust systems, and suspension components, where it needs to withstand extreme heat and maintain its functionality.

The versatility of stainless spring steel extends to its range of available forms and finishes. It can be manufactured in various shapes, such as sheets, coils, strips, bars, and wires, to meet the specific requirements of different applications. Additionally, stainless spring steel can be cold-rolled, heat-treated, or coated to enhance its mechanical properties or improve its appearance. This versatility allows manufacturers to tailor the material to their exact needs, further expanding its applicability.

In addition to its mechanical and chemical properties, stainless spring steel is also known for its aesthetic appeal. Its smooth and shiny finish gives it a visually pleasing appearance, making it a popular choice for architectural and decorative applications. Stainless spring steel can be found in building facades, handrails, interior design elements, and even jewelry.

 

 

Another advantage of stainless spring steel is its recyclability. Being a sustainable material, stainless steel can be melted down and reused without losing its properties. This not only reduces the environmental impact but also makes it an economical choice in the long run.

In conclusion, stainless spring steel is a versatile and durable material that offers exceptional performance in various applications. Its resistance to corrosion, high strength, heat resistance, and aesthetic appeal make it a preferred choice across industries. Furthermore, the ability to customize its form and finish, along with its recyclability, adds to its versatility and cost-effectiveness. As technology advances and new applications emerge, stainless spring steel will continue to play a vital role in enhancing the performance and reliability of different components.
